A serial entrepreneur with deep international experience, Bertrand Diard is the co-founder of Syroco, the next generation innovation lab that looks at improving the systemic efficiency of energy and transportation industries. 
Before Syroco, Bertrand had co-founded and managed Talend, one of the most successful open source vendors in the world andone of the very few French companies traded on the Nasdaq stock exchange, and Influans, an ultrapersonalization marketing platform that was sold to Ogury in 2018. Bertrand is also a board member for BonitaSoft, CybelAngel, Hull.io, iBanFirst and The Galion Project and was the president of Tech In France for several years. He launched alongside Serena Capital, Serena Data Ventures, the first European fund dedicated to data and artificial intelligence, and invests as a Business Angel in innovative startups.

Oscar Salazar is one of the most influential figures in the modern tech industry. Salazar is the Founding-CTO and Architect of Uber. He was responsible for the creation of the initial prototypes for Uber’s customer app, driver app and dispatch engine.Salazar is also the founder of Citivox, Pager and RIDE. Citivox is an international companydesigned to enable NGOs and individuals to report and monitor electoral fraud, crime and infrastructure problems. Pager is an Uber like concept designed to connect patients with high quality health care providers. RIDE is an application that enables co-workers to carpool to work.Salazar graduated with a Bachelor of Science degree from the Universidad de Colima in Mexico. He later earned a M.Sc. in Electrical and Computer Engineering from University of Calgary in Canada and a Ph.D. in Telecommunications from Ecole Nationale Superieure des Telecommunications.

## Jacques-Antoine Granjon
- Type: Angel
- Location: La Plaine-saint-denis, Ile-de-France, France
- Relevant deals: 1
- Stages: Series A, Seed
- Focus: Software, E-Commerce, Advertising

Jacques-Antoine Granjon was born in Marseille on 9th August 1962 and studied at the prestigious European Business School (EBS). A born entrepreneur, he founded overstock distributer Cofotex S.A. with EBS friend Julien Sorbac in 1985. In 1996, Jacques-Antoine bought and renovated the former print works of national French newspaper Le Monde in LaPlaine Saint-Denis (93), just outside of Paris, setting up Oredis group HQ.In 2000, he and his business partners realised that the Internet was “an opportunity to welcome the world in a virtual store with digital catalogues”. This realization led to the creation of a revolutionary concept: an online platform entirely dedicated to flash sales for brands.In January 2001, Jacques-Antoine and his seven business partners launched vente-privee.com in France, before e-commerce had barely started in Europe. He then applied his extensive experience to the Internet, selling excess stock for important fashion and home brands, relying on two main strategies: events and exclusivity, all the while focusing on customer satisfaction. In 2012, he went on to win the “Customer Service Award” for the fourth year in a row, presented to him by the Institute BVA-Viséo Conseil, France’s fourth market research company.It was not until 2004 that the website’s success became apparent. In 2005, its turnover grew a staggering 500% from the previous year. The website is now available in 8 European countries (France, Germany, Spain, Italy, UK, Belgium and Austria, and the Netherlands) and the United States, in partnership with American Express. In 12 years, vente-privee.com has become an event-creating media, bringing together over 18 million members and 2.5 million unique users per day. This solid foundation allows the site to offer its 2,000 partner brands an innovative distribution channel.Jacques-Antoine Granjon’s professional success has been recognized with many awards. He was named ‘2011 Communication Personality of the Year’ by the Grand Prix des Agences de l’Année, ‘Personality of the Year’ by the Trophées LSA de l’Innovation 2011, ‘Innovator of the Year’ at the 2011 Technologies Numériques awards, ‘2011 Man of the Year’ by the Enseignes d’Or panel and ‘2010 Businessman of the Year’ by French GQ readers. Jacques-Antoine was also crowned ‘E-commerce Man of the Year’ by a panel of internet users at the E-commerce Magazine awards in 2007 then ‘Businessman of the Year’ at the BFM Awards in 2008. He also then went on to collect the European prize for ‘Chief Marketing Office of the year’, sponsored by Booz & Company, in 2009.
